A Trial to Compare the Efficacy and Safety of Once-weekly Lonapegsomatropin With Placebo and a Daily Somatropin Product in Adults With Growth Hormone Deficiency
Completed · Phase 3 · Has a placebo group
Conditions studied: Growth Hormone Deficiency, Endocrine System Diseases, Hormone Deficiency
In brief
A 38-week dosing trial of lonapegsomatropin, a long-acting growth hormone product, administered once-a-week versus placebo-control. A daily somatropin product arm is also included to assist clinical judgement on the trial results. A total of 264 adults (males and females) with growth hormone deficiency were included. Randomization occurred in a 1:1:1 ratio (lonapegsomatropin: placebo: daily somatropin product). This is a global trial conducted in, but not limited to, the United States, Europe, and Asia.

Who can join
Age: 23 and older, up to 80.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- Age between 23 and 80 years, inclusive, at screening.
- Adult Growth Hormone Deficiency (AGHD) Diagnosis Criteria
- For adult-onset AGHD: documented history of structural hypothalamic-pituitary disease, hypothalamic-pituitary surgery, cranial irradiation, 1-4 non-GH pituitary hormone deficiencies, a proven genetic cause of GHD, or traumatic brain injury (TBI).
- Participants with childhood-onset GHD must have had GH axis re-assessed at final height.
- In participants with TBI as a cause of GHD, GHD must be confirmed by GH -stimulation testing performed at least 12 months after the injury.
- A. For all countries except Japan: participants must have satisfied at least one of the following criteria:
- Insulin tolerance test: peak growth hormone (GH) <=5 ng/mL
- Glucagon stimulation test according to body mass index (BMI)
- i. BMI <=30 kg/m\^2: peak GH <=3 ng/mL
- ii. BMI >30 kg/m\^2: peak GH <=1 ng/mL
- Three or four pituitary axis deficiencies (i.e., adrenal, thyroid, gonadal, and/or vasopressin; not including GH) with insulin-like growth factor-1 standard deviation score (IGF-1 SDS) <= -2.0 at screening
- Macimorelin test: peak GH <=2.8 ng/mL
- Growth hormone releasing hormone (GHRH) + arginine test according to BMI:
- i. BMI <25 kg/m\^2, peak GH <11 ng/mL
- ii. BMI >=25-<=30 kg/m\^2, peak GH <8 ng/mL
- iii. BMI >30 kg/m\^2, peak GH <4 ng/mL
- B. For Japan only: Participants with AGHD and deficiency of at least one non-GH pituitary hormones need to satisfy one of the following GH stimulation tests. Participants with GHD without additional non-GH pituitary hormone deficiencies with or without and evidence of intracranial structure disorder need to satisfy at least 2 of the following stimulation tests:
- Insulin tolerance test: peak GH <=1.8 ng/mL
- Glucagon test: peak GH <=1.8 ng/mL
- Growth Hormone Releasing Peptide-2 (GHRP-2) tolerance test: peak GH <=9 ng/mL
- IGF-1 SDS <= -1.0 at screening as measured by central laboratory.
- hGH treatment naïve or no exposure to hGH therapy or GH secretagogue for at least 12 months prior to screening.
- For participants on hormone replacement therapies for any hormone deficiencies other than GH (e.g., adrenal, thyroid, estrogen, testosterone) must be on adequate and stable doses for >=6 weeks prior to and throughout screening.
- For participants not on glucocorticoid replacement therapy, documentation of adequate adrenal function at screening defined as: morning (6:00-10:00 AM) serum cortisol >15.0 mcg/dL (measured at central laboratory) and/or adrenocorticotropic hormone (ACTH) stimulation test or insulin tolerance test with serum cortisol >18.0 mcg/dL at or within 90 days prior to screening.
- For males not on testosterone replacement therapy: morning (6:00 - 10:00AM) total testosterone within normal limits for age.
You may not qualify if…
- Known Prader-Willi Syndrome and/or other genetic diseases that may have an impact on an endpoint.
- Diabetes mellitus at screening if any of the following criteria are met:
- Poorly controlled diabetes, defined as HbA1c >7.5% at screening.
- Diabetes mellitus (defined as HbA1c >=6.5% and/or fasting plasma glucose >=126 mg/dL and/or plasma glucose >=200 mg/dL two hours after oral glucose tolerance test) diagnosed <26 weeks prior to screening
- Change in diabetes regimen (includes dose adjustment) within <90 days prior and throughout screening
- Use of any diabetes drugs other than metformin and/or dipeptidyl peptidase-4 (DPP-4) inhibitors for a cumulative duration of greater than 4 weeks within 12 months prior to screening
- Diabetes-related complications at screening (i.e., nephropathy as judged by the investigator, neuropathy requiring pharmacological treatment, retinopathy stage 2/moderate and above within 90 days prior to screening or during screening)
- Active malignant disease or history of malignancy. Exceptions to this exclusion criterion:
- Resection of in situ carcinoma of the cervix uteri
- Complete eradication of squamous cell or basal cell carcinoma of the skin
- Participants with GHD attributed to treatment of intracranial malignant tumors or leukemia, provided that a recurrence-free survival period of at least 5 years prior to screening is documented in the participant's file (based on a Magnetic Resonance Imaging (MRI) result for intracranial malignant tumors)
- Evidence of growth of pituitary adenoma or other benign intracranial tumor within the last 12 months before screening.
- Participants with acromegaly without remission / with documented remission less than 24 months prior to screening.
- Participants with Cushing's disease without remission / with documented remission less than 24 months prior to screening.
- Participants with prior cranial irradiation or hypothalamic-pituitary surgery: the procedure was to take place less than 12 months prior to screening.
- Estimated glomerular filtration rate (eGFR) <60 mL/min/1.73m\^2 determined based on Modification of Diet in Renal Disease (MDRD) equation.
- Hepatic transaminases (i.e., aspartate aminotransferase [AST] or alanine aminotransferase [ALT]) >3 times the upper limit of normal.
- Heart failure New York Heart Association (NYHA) class 3 or greater (NYHA 1994).
- Q-T interval, corrected by Fridericia's method (QTcF) >= 451 milliseconds on 12-lead electrocardiogram (ECG) at screening.
- Poorly controlled hypertension, defined as supine systolic blood pressure >159 mmHg and/or supine diastolic blood pressure >95 mmHg at screening.
- Cerebrovascular accident within 5 years prior to screening.
- Anabolic steroids (other than gonadal steroid replacement therapy) or oral/intravenous/intramuscular corticosteroids within 90 days prior to or throughout screening.
- Currently using or have used within 26 weeks prior to screening any weight-loss or appetite-suppressive medications including orlistat, zonisamide, lorcaserin, bupropion, topiramate, sibutramine, stimulants, glucagon-like peptide 1 (GLP-1) receptor agonists, sodium-dependent glucose cotransporters (SGLT-2) inhibitors or medications that affects IGF-1 or GH measurements including cabergoline at doses above 0.5 mg weekly or bromocriptine at doses above 20 mg weekly.
- Known history of hypersensitivity and/or idiosyncrasy to any of the test compounds (somatropin) or excipients employed in this trial.
- Known history of neutralizing anti-hGH antibodies.
